Recognizing Water Damage Restoration Services
Exactly what does water damage restoration require? Water damage restoration encompasses a collection of careful procedures focused on recouping buildings affected by water invasion. Originally, it involves assessing the degree of damage to establish the necessary steps for restoration. Technicians after that utilize specific equipment to essence standing water and wetness from impacted areas. This is adhered to by comprehensive drying and evaporating to stop mold and mildew growth and architectural damage. Furthermore, restoration solutions consist of cleansing and sanitizing contaminated surface areas and materials. Repairing or replacing personal belongings and broken frameworks is also a crucial component. In general, the goal of water damage restoration is to restore the residential property to its pre-damage problem, guaranteeing a safe and healthy and balanced atmosphere for passengers.

Licensing and Insurance Confirmation
Confirming that a water damage restoration business has the correct licensing and insurance is necessary for homeowners looking for reliable solution. Flood Cleanup Services. Licensed business show conformity with local laws, which often require adherence to safety and quality requirements. Home owners should confirm that the firm holds valid licenses specific to water damage restoration, as these credentials show a commitment to professionalism and reliability
Insurance insurance coverage is similarly important; it protects home owners from potential obligations and problems sustained throughout the restoration procedure. A trusted company ought to offer evidence of basic obligation and employees' compensation insurance coverage. Homeowners are urged to demand and evaluate these documents prior to employing a company, as this step guarantees satisfaction and safeguards versus unanticipated expenses or lawful issues.

Understanding the Restoration Process and Equipment Used
A check here detailed understanding of the water damage restoration procedure and the tools utilized is crucial for property owners encountering such emergency situations. The restoration procedure usually involves several vital steps: analysis, water extraction, drying out, and restoration. Initially, professionals evaluate the damage and recognize the resource of water breach. High-powered pumps and vacuum cleaners are then employed for effective water extraction. After removal, indust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ers are made use of to completely dry influenced areas completely, minimizing mold and mildew growth (Water Damage Restoration). When drying out is complete, restoration may include repairs, painting, and replacing broken products. Recognizing this process aids house owners appreciate the significance of specific tools and the experience required for reliable restoration, guaranteeing a speedy go back to normalcy after a water damage case
